School Trip to Leucate

Last week, our secondary school pupils swapped the classroom for the coast and set off on an unforgettable two-day trip to Leucate.

The adventure began with a visit to Fontfroide Abbey, where centuries of history can be felt in every stone. Afterwards, it was straight to the beach, where pupils from all year groups competed in mixed teams. The youngest and oldest worked side by side, with plenty of new friendships formed along the way.

The evening brought its own share of excitement. Each class was given a surprise challenge and had to put together a performance on the spot. The result was an impressive display of creativity and far more laughter than rehearsal time. After all, you get to know your classmates in a completely different way when you have just twenty minutes to come up with something together.

On Friday, it was time for the hike. There were a few tired legs, but the stunning views more than made up for it. The day ended back at the impressive Château de Salses, which served as both the starting and finishing point of the walk.

Two days away from the classroom, yet so much learning still took place: lessons in teamwork, trust and thinking on your feet, all of which are difficult to find in any textbook.
